    Harvard University Aspire Emerging Leaders Program Eligibility

    The program is suitable for students from socially and economically disadvantaged backgrounds. All applicants must meet the following criteria:

    • 18-26 years old
    • low income background
    • First-generation college-goers (parents and/or primary caregivers who did not complete a bachelor’s degree)
    • Enrolled in an undergraduate program or recently graduated (within three years)

    or

    • Education affected by natural disasters and/or armed conflict (i.e. refugees or displaced persons)

    For more details on eligibility, see FAQ.

    Harvard Aspire Emerging Leaders Program Application Timeline

    Applications for the first cycle of the 2023 Aspire Leadership Program (ALP) will open on November 16, 2022.

    Early Action Deadline: December 14, 2022

    Deadline: January 11, 2023

    Once accepted into the Aspire Leaders Program, emerging leaders will begin the multi-phase program in January or February 2023, subject to eligibility.
